    If you get hydroponic fertiliser they can live in water full time. I use “GT Foliage Focus” as it’s what’s available where I live.

    I know you didn’t ask about this, but your pothos is a pretty leggy. The gaps between the leaves indicate it is receiving insufficient light. I recommend chopping it up and propagating each leaf in water, then making sure they all get more significantly more light.

    It can last a very long time in water but once in a while you’ll need to fertilize the water since there are no nutrients in water. Also as the roots get longer and thicker you’ll need a bigger container or cut the roots back if you keep it in the same jar or they get very tangled and slimy green which will lead to rot.
